They have the height at 5'1" to 5'3", so there is already a 3" range for her probable height. Assuming that they measured the bones correctly, and Nancy Jo's height is correctly noted, it would be pretty far off.

However, on two MP cases (Robert Donlick and Troy Kozkowski) matched to UID's by Websleuths members, the difference between the measured height of the UID and the reported height of the MP were 4" and 3", respectively. And these weren't skeletal remains cases, they were intact bodies.

So as I said above, you can't always presume that heights are correct.
 
I think Nancy's eyes are very similar to the Jane Doe's eyes. I think the overall appearance is also very similar.
 
Another thing to keep in mind is that in many instances, these cases remain unresolved for so long because something is incorrect.

I've seen three cases in recent years that remained unresolved because of incorrect Dates of Last Contact. I've also seen a few with wildly incorrect age estimates and, as I mentioned above, incorrect heights.

I-270 connects to I-70. That leads up to Pennsylvania. I-81 and I-76 connect later on. She was found on I-270 southbound. Maybe if the trucker was responsible, he picked her up somewhere north of the area. Maybe we could check to see if anyone fits her description from Pennsylvania or New York... I wish we could find out his driving route.

There was a truck stop in Frederick at this time. I think that's always been the theory that she may have been with a trucker. There were a number of "lot lizards" working the truck stop at the time. According to what I was told, they interviewed the women working there and none of them recognized her.

I've always suspected this might be a local person.

Where she was found isn't an area you'd dump a body at unless you knew the area . First off, it's on a highway. I'm pretty sure there's a guardrail there too, so you'd have to lift the body over it if that were the case. There is an underpass right where she was found and a parking lot right at the underpass. She was found down an embankment. Someone knew that embankment was there, because people aren't just going to pull over and throw out a body on flat ground right off the highway.

I suspect whomever did this is very familiar with that area. The parking lot I mention is part of the Monocacy Battlefield called Worthington Farm and has several hiking trails. The park closes at dark.

http://articles.philly.com/2003-02-14/news/25450568_1_bell-bottoms-jeans-b-nai-b-rith

In the 1980s, Capital Pants began producing jeans for tall women under its tony Cap Ferrat label. When the grunge look became popular, the company sold used jeans.
